Exploring the regulatory and structural parameters required for compliance in European Union markets.
Under Directive 2014/30/EU, CE-certified electric drives are tested to ensure they do not emit electromagnetic interference (EMI) that disrupts other equipment, while remaining immune to external radiation.
Adhering to Directive 2014/35/EU, our drives operating within 50–1000V AC or 75–1500V DC undergo isolation testing, dielectric withstand tests, and leakage current evaluations to eliminate hazards.
We comply fully with restriction criteria of hazardous substances (lead, mercury, cadmium). This ecological accountability guarantees trouble-free custom clearance and simplifies recycling paths.

A B2B guide comparing common drive setups to align with your application parameters.
| Drive Classification | Common Voltage Ranges | Ideal Torque & Speed Bounds | Primary Sector Application | Key Performance Strengths |
|---|---|---|---|---|
| Planetary BLDC | 12V, 24V, 48V DC | High Torque, Moderate Speed | Robotics, AGVs, Medical Equipment | Excellent power density, high efficiency |
| Worm Geared Drives | 6V, 12V, 24V DC | High Torque, Lower RPM | Smart Valves, Automation, Cleaners | Self-locking mechanism, quiet operation |
| Micro Coreless Motors | 1.5V - 6V DC | Low Torque, Ultra High Speed | Medical Devices, Haptic Feedbacks | Rapid acceleration, zero cogging torque |
| AC Shaded Pole Motors | 120V, 220V - 240V AC | Medium Torque, Stable RPM | Home Appliances, Pellet Stoves, BBQ | Cost-effective, robust high-temp resilience |

Understanding where the micro-motion industry is heading over the next five years.
Due to the requirements of high operating efficiency and sparks elimination, industrial sectors are phasing out brushed setups in favor of Brushless DC (BLDC) solutions. BLDC drives provide lower operational friction, minimal thermal output, and dramatically prolonged operating life.
Smart surgical tools, robotic hands, and handheld equipment require drives that deliver significant torque within sub-20mm dimensional constraints. High-flux density magnet assemblies and computerized precision winding are key drivers of this trend.
Modern electric drives are no longer standalone rotary pieces; they require built-in closed-loop feedback systems like hall sensors, optical encoders, and integrated drive chips. This allows direct communication with central computers via CAN-bus, Modbus, or EtherCAT protocols.
